Ricochet’s situation took a serious turn this week thanks to his controversial MS tweet— and now there’s a clear answer about who stepped in behind the scenes when things spiraled.
After the AEW star faced heavy backlash for his offensive comment toward a fan with multiple sclerosis, questions started circulating about who advised him to delete the tweet and issue an apology. Now, that piece of the story is out. According to Fightful Select, the longtime friend who reached out to Ricochet and advised him during the controversy has been identified and it’s none other than Chris Hero.
"Those that we spoke to in AEW say that Chris Hero was the person who reached out to Ricochet to give him advice on the disrespectful MS tweet."
Chris Hero — a respected veteran and longtime friend — is now being credited as the one who got through to Ricochet when the backlash hit its peak, leading to the tweet being deleted and the apology being posted.
And that lines up with what we already knew — Ricochet’s response wasn’t damage control from the company, it was a personal decision influenced by someone he trusts. Bottom line — when things got messy, AEW stayed out of it, and Chris Hero stepped in.
